Don't turn left!
Into the old entrance of the site! You now have to go about 50 yeards further on before you can turn.
It will be the first thing that you notice as you arrive (well, if you've been before!) I can tell you it's quite difficult not to! Every instinct says turn left at the end of trees, especially when you have been doing it for the last tweny years or so...even before that, when Fforest Fields was the Little Flat, that was where the entrance was, so it's taken quite a bit of getting used to! But what George and Will have done during the winter months is a huge improvement. We now have one entrance and exit, no cars driving round the site, unless they are going to their pitch, so much less traffic movement, much safer for children and much quieter and less dusty for you.
